Xiaomi 16 series launch confirmed earlier than expected

Xiaomi’s leadership has officially acknowledged an earlier-than-expected launch for the highly anticipated Xiaomi 16 series. Lu Weibing, Xiaomi Group partner and president of the mobile division, confirmed the news with a direct statement, hinting at imminent market entry. This move signals Xiaomi’s intent to directly challenge Apple’s September iPhone release and Huawei’s high-profile tri-fold device. The autumn flagship race is intensifying, and Xiaomi is positioning itself as a central player. Strategic Timing in the Autumn Flagship Market

September is shaping up to be the most competitive month in the smartphone sector. Huawei has already made waves with its innovative tri-fold device, raising industry standards and consumer expectations. Apple maintains its established September 10th timeline for the iPhone 17, reinforcing its yearly cadence and customer anticipation.

By moving its Xiaomi 16 series launch forward, Xiaomi signals a strategic shift, aiming to capture market share during this critical sales period. This is a significant departure from its traditional release schedule and reflects the company’s agile response to market dynamics.

Xiaomi 16 Series: Key Value Propositions

Early information indicates the Xiaomi 16 series will introduce substantial technological advancements. Notably, the devices are expected to be among the first equipped with the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5 processor, ensuring high-level performance.

Camera system upgrades are anticipated to include:

  • Optimized low-light photography
  • Improved dynamic range
  • Advanced focus tracking
  • Enhanced Leica Master photography modes
  • More customizable watermark features

Battery Efficiency and Display Innovations

Xiaomi is reportedly focusing on battery longevity, combining larger battery capacities with new low-power display technologies. The result should be extended device usage between charges.

The integration of HyperOS 3 will further optimize system efficiency, maximizing both performance and battery life. Daily usability is expected to improve compared to prior generations.

In terms of design, Xiaomi is refining its camera modules, offering choices such as a small rectangle, a larger matrix, or compact screen layouts—each providing a premium look and feel comparable to leading competitors.

By advancing its release schedule, Xiaomi is squarely positioning itself against Apple and Huawei for share of the high-end smartphone market in autumn 2025.
